ABOUT US

Canadian Classics Rugby is a non-profit organization that strives to operate in accordance with the provisions of our national governing body, Rugby Canada.

​

Initially formed in 1995 by Canadian International Tom Woods the Classics seek to connect and build friendships throughout the global rugby community. Through a quarter-century of reuniting former national team players, running kids camps, and raising funds for others we have recognized 2 key factors that have helped our program evolve

​

1.    A lifetime of service to rugby can take its toll on our bodies, minds, spirits, and support networks - which has unfortunately left some truly outstanding players unavailable for Classics selection, and;

                                   

2.    Canada is blessed with many talented, capable, and deserving rugby players who haven't had a chance to wear a maple leaf.....until now!"

 

Today the Classics not only seek to reunite Canada’s former representatives, but also to supplement them with top provincial, regional, and club players to form outstanding invitational touring sides.
